J

Jodi Taylor
Review of Tecvox

8 months ago

Tecvox products are great! Their website tecvox.co...

Tecvox products are great! Their website tecvox.com offers a wide selection that caters to different preferences. The quality is top-notch, and the customer support team is always helpful and quick to respond. I couldn't be happier with my experience with Tecvox.

Comments:

No comments